【Linux】整理一些linux常用指令(2)——网络设置相关

本文介绍了如何在Linux系统中查看和管理网络状态,包括检查IP分配方式、路由列表以及启动/停止网络服务。接着,详细阐述了安装ApacheWeb服务器的步骤,启用HTTP和HTTPS服务,并通过防火墙设置允许外部访问。此外,还提到了如何配置多站点以及编辑HTTP服务器配置文件以监听不同IP地址。
摘要由CSDN通过智能技术生成

#网络设置相关

查看网络状态:
cd /etc/sysconfig/network-scripts
cat ifcfg-eno1677736
检查BOOTPROTO, 代表IP分配方式
route 查看路由列表
route -n 查看IP分配
systemctl status network.service 检查网络状态
systemctl start?stop?restart network.service 使用start或stop指令开启或关闭网络服务,使用 restart重启
ifdowm +interface号关闭interfce
ipconfig 查看IP状态
cat /etc/resolv.conf查看域名与IP映射
cat /etc/hosts 查看本机IP映射

#安装Apache Web Server

sudo dnf install httpd
sudo enable httpd.service启用HTPP服务
sudo systemctl start heepd.service启用apache服务
sudo firewall-cmd --permanent --add-service=http 防火墙允许通过HTTP协议访问本机网页
sudo firewall-cmd --permanent --add-service=https 防火墙允许通过HTTPS协议访问本机网页
sudo firewall-cmd --add-service=http
sudo firewall-cmd --add-service=https立即开放防火墙,此时通过浏览器在地址栏输入虚拟机地址应该可以访问到apache测试页
cd /var/www/html
vi index.html 定位并编辑主页

#管理多个站点
ifconfig eno16777736:0 192.168.232.140 netmask 255.255.255.0
ifconfig eno16777736:1 192.168.232.150 netmask 255.255.255.0
把eno16777736接口配置在140和150两个地址

vi /etc/httpd/conf/httpd.conf 打开配置文件
/Listen 查看监听端口
Listen 192.168.232.140:80 添加一个对于140:80的监听
O 返回插入模式

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值